Andrew Sacher
Andrew Sacher is an economist known for his insights into monetary policy and financial markets. He has contributed to discussions on interest rates and inflation, particularly in the context of Federal Reserve decisions. His recent analyses have highlighted the expectations of investors regarding interest rate hikes and their implications for the economy.
